The National Agencies of the YOUTH IN ACTION programme from Germany, Belgium-Flanders and Hungary have the task to implement the EU’s youth programme YOUTH IN ACTION. In this context they are working on the programme’s permanent priorities Inclusion of young people with fewer opportunities and Participation of young people. The SALTO-YOUTH Resource Centres SALTO Inclusion and SALTO Participation support the programme, National Agencies and the youth field with the expertise on the respective topics.

Civic participation concerns all young people, but youngsters with fewer opportunities are still underrepresented in civic participation projects. In the current YOUTH IN ACTION programme civic participation projects are mostly realized in the Actions 1.3 (Youth Democracy Projects) and 5.1 (Meetings of young people and those responsible for youth policy (Structured Dialogue)). In the future youth programme YOUTH IN ACTION within the integrated programme  Erasmus + (E+) civic or citizenship projects will most likely take place within the new Key Action 2 (Cooperation for innovation and good practices - Strategic Partnerships). As the possible project formats within this new Key Action are still quite open, it is important to offer beneficiaries a possibility to gain a better understanding of the opportunities that lie within this Key Action. A Project Greenhouse as we foresee it will bring together experienced beneficiaries to develope new project formats and activities in a creative and open atmosphere. The expected outcome should be a collection of projects and strategies that could be realized within the different key actions of E+ (especially the yet undefined Key Action 2). So, the Greenhouse will also contribute to a sharpened understanding of the opportunities within the new youth programme, especially of the strategic partnerships in Key Action 2.

To keep the spirit of important priorities as Inclusion and Participation alive in the new youth programme the Greenhouse shall specifically deal with the question of how to involve young people with fewer opportunities in decision making projects? Thus, Participation in this seminar will be less understood as active involvement in projects in general but perceived in a more political sense as taking an active part in democratic and civic processes.

Therefore the opportunities the programme Erasmus+ offers to identify synergies between the already existing expertise regarding participation and inclusion will be explored. Youth workers and young people with experience – on the one hand with inclusion projects and on the other hand with participation projects –will come together to share their experiences in a first step. Inclusion experts might present good practice examples how to involve young people with fewer opportunities, willing to step forward to civic participation projects with their target group. Participation experts might present good practice examples of civic participation projects, aiming at better reaching young people with fewer opportunities. In a second step these experts will enter an open and creative workshop process to develop ideas for possible common projects and cooperations. (There might also be a third expert group: those experienced in national inclusion and participation projects, willing to go international.)
